Who are we?

Picture
The Dunedin South Presbyterian Church was formed in 1994 by the Parishes of St James and Musselburgh/Tainui, joining together.  We are a congregation which has enjoyed strong evangelical ministries.  Our members sit confortably with the holistic creeds of the Church.

We are a Parish of the Presbyterian Chuch of Aotearoa New Zealand.  We hold the scriptures of the
Old and New Testament as the supreme standard of faith.  We are growing to be a mission
minded Parish and are not ashamed to Preach the gospel of Jesus Christ. 
We do not preach ourselves, but Jesus Christ as the crucified Lord.

We welcome all people and seek to serve them to the glory of God.

CHURCH MINISTER

Rev. Henry Mbambo

Rev. Henry Mbambo - sermons
Henry was inducted as minister of Dunedin South Presbyterian Church in October 2008. He previously served the congregation of Garden Presbyterian Church in Lusaka, Zambia for seven years before moving to New Zealand.

Graduating from Justo Mwale Theological College in Lusaka, Zambia in 1998, Henry went on to do his  BA (Hons)studies  at the University of Pretoria in South Africa in 2002. In 2004, he studied for his Masters.  The Masters work was in the area of Practical Theology at the University of Pretoria which he did from 2004-2005.

He graduated with a distinction in the Master’s thesis focusing on Domestic Violence. Before moving to New Zealand, Henry completed another Masters Degree in Theological Studies at Eden Theological Seminary in St. Louis, MO, USA. There he majored in Mission and the thesis was on building local Churches that are “Self-governing, Self-propagating and Self- supporting.”


Henry’s vision statement;
“My vision for the Dunedin South parish is to build a church that is missional, responding to the needs in the local community and beyond. A church that will always be nurtured for mission and engaging in mission is what we want to become for the sake of Christ our Lord.”
